  • Refusal Review.

    Before signing a retainer with us, your refusal history must be discussed. We can do so within this consultation period. If you already have the Officer Notes, we will analyse them with you. If not, we will apply for these on your behalf. 

    ​Previous refusals cannot simply be swept under the blanket. Each one must be fully addressed when applying for any further application.

    Please note:  Refugee claimants are different from an immigrant in that an immigrant chooses to settle in another country whereas a refugee is forcd to flee for their safety. 

    ​Claimants may iether apply as refugees through the United Nations where if they are approved, will be placed in a ountry at their discretion. If claiming refugee protection in Canada, you must be inside of Canada and must meet the criteria. 

     Canada’s asylum system helps people who have fled their countries because of a well-founded fear of persecution. This means that some people may be able to ask for refugee protection if returning to their home country puts them at risk. A danger of torture, a risk to your life, or a risk of cruel and unusual treatment or punishment. 

     It is not a short cut to immigrating to Canada, the risk of refusals are high. The process of proving your story is stressful, vigorous and evidence is required.

  • Humanitarian and Compassionate Applications.

    Please note Canada has a history of extending compassion to those in need. However, this application  requires very specific criteria to be in place. This is not a "catch all" application and furthermore, can take many months, even years before  decision is made.  

    Who may use this application?

    ​You may use this application to apply for permanent residence from within Canada on humanitarian and compassionate grounds (H&C) if you:

    ​- are a foreign national currently living in Canada;

    - need an exemption from one or more requirements of the Immigration and Refugee Protection Act (IRPA) or Regulations to apply for permanent residence within Canada;

    - are not eligible to apply for permanent residence within Canada under any other immigration class, but believe that your circumstances justify H&C considerations for the granting of PR

    ​Do not use this application if you are eligible to apply for permanent residence in any of these classes:

    ​- Spouse or Common-Law Partner;

    - Economic;

    - Protected Person and Convention Refugees; or

    - Temporary Resident Permit (TRP) Holder.

     It is not a short cut to immigrating to Canada, the risk of refusals are high. The process of proving your story is stressful, vigorous and evidence is required. 

    ​Applying for H&C consideration is an exceptional measure – it is not simply another means of applying for permanent resident status in Canada.

    To be considered for an exemption from the usual requirements of IRPA, you must:

    ​clearly indicate in your application the specific exemption(s) you are requesting.

    provide all details related to your request including the reasons why you believe an exemption(s) should be granted on H&C grounds.

    demonstrate that there are sufficient and compelling reasons for you to be granted an exemption allowing you to apply for permanent residence from within Canada.

    NoteThe cost and inconvenience associated with returning to your home country to apply for permanent residence are not, in the absence of other compelling factors, sufficient factors for H&C considerations.
